Southern Company (SOJC) reported first-quarter 2026 earnings per share of $1.32, surpassing the consensus estimate of $1.2464 by a positive surprise of 5.905%. Revenue figures were not disclosed. Despite the earnings beat, the price of the Series 2017B junior subordinated notes declined by 0.7% on the day of the release, likely reflecting broader market movements or profit-taking following a strong quarterly performance.

Management highlighted that the earnings beat was driven by solid operational performance across its regulated electric and gas utilities, as well as effective cost management. In the first quarter, Southern Company benefited from robust customer growth in its Southeast service territories, along with favorable weather patterns that boosted electricity demand for heating. The company also reported stable margins in its generation and transmission segments, supported by ongoing investments in grid modernization and reliability. Operational highlights included the continued ramp-up of the Vogtle nuclear expansion, which is contributing incremental capacity and revenue. Additionally, the company’s natural gas distribution business experienced higher throughput due to colder-than-normal temperatures in key markets. Management noted that disciplined expense control and efficiency initiatives helped offset inflationary pressures on labor and materials. The reported EPS of $1.32 reflects a solid start to the year, with the company maintaining its focus on delivering reliable service while prudently managing its capital structure. The slight negative price reaction in the notes may indicate that some investors had priced in an even larger beat, but overall fundamentals remain sound. Looking ahead, Southern Company’s management expressed confidence in its strategic priorities, which include regulatory stability, infrastructure investment, and a balanced approach to capital allocation. The company anticipates continued customer growth and expects to benefit from its diversified generation mix, which includes nuclear, natural gas, and renewables. While no specific fiscal 2026 guidance was updated, management reiterated its long-term earnings growth targets, supported by its capital investment plan. However, risks remain, including the potential for higher interest rates, which could increase financing costs for the regulated utilities, and the possibility of more stringent environmental regulations. On the operational side, the company is closely monitoring supply chain dynamics for key equipment and materials. Management also noted that it expects to maintain its dividend payout ratio consistent with historical levels, which is supportive for the junior subordinated notes that are deeply dependent on Southern Company’s credit quality. The overall outlook remains cautiously optimistic, with an emphasis on executing its regulated growth strategy while navigating macroeconomic uncertainties. The market’s response to the earnings announcement was muted, with SOJC’s notes declining 0.7%. This slight pullback could reflect a broader market sell-off or a modest rebalancing after the stock’s recent performance. Analysts covering Southern Company’s preferred securities have pointed out that the notes are less sensitive to quarterly earnings surprises and more influenced by credit ratings and interest rate trends. Some analysts viewed the EPS beat as a positive sign for the company’s ability to generate stable cash flows, which underpins the notes’ interest payments. However, they caution that the fixed-income nature of the security means that movements in Treasury yields could have a more significant impact on price than short-term operational results. Going forward, investors should watch for updates on regulatory proceedings, capital expenditure plans, and the company’s leverage metrics. The combination of a solid operational quarter and a slight yield increase from the price decline may present an opportunity for income-focused investors, but cautious language remains warranted given the interest rate environment.
